Subject: GC pauses in MatchWeave — hold promotion

MatchWeave matching nodes are hitting 900ms GC pauses under peak load since the 4.2 rollout. Throughput drops ~18% during collection cycles; queue depth recovers but SLO breach is likely tonight. We've switched the staging fleet to the tuned collector profile and pauses fall under 120ms. Recommend holding promotion until soak completes tomorrow. Repro steps and heap dumps attached to the incident doc. Verified against the build below.

pipeline stamp: htk3_69f

# Break-Glass: Catalog Cache Invalidation

Scope: the Pinrow product catalog at Veldstone Retail. If stale prices persist after a purge and the Hollowmere invalidation queue is wedged, use break-glass to flush the edge tier directly. Contractors: get verbal sign-off from the catalog lead first. Steps: open the Hollowmere admin shell, select emergency-flush, confirm the tenant, and run it once — repeated flushes thrash the origin. Access is logged and expires after 20 minutes. Unseal the admin shell with the passphrase below.

recovery phrase for kahop-tajog: istix-casvan

## Deploying the Gatewick Proctor Queue

Deploys are pretty painless: push to main, wait for the pipeline, then watch the queue drain dashboard for five minutes. If candidates pile up mid-exam, roll back first and ask questions later — the queue replays safely. Everything the workers care about lives in one config block, shown here for reference.

settings of bafof-yagef:
JOROX_PIN=8740
JOROX_TENANT=pelox
JOROX_METRICS_HOST=metrics.jorox.qorvelworks.internal
JOROX_SEAL=seal_c78f63c1
JOROX_STANDBY_TEAM=norax

# Telemetry compression config — Vantrel ingest tier.
# Payloads over 4KB get zstd-compressed before hitting the Corvane pipeline.
# COMPRESS_LEVEL: 1-9, default 6. Higher burns CPU on the edge nodes.
# COMPRESS_MIN_BYTES: skip compression below this threshold.
# Do not disable compression in prod; the collector rejects raw payloads over 64KB.
# Rotate quarterly per the maintenance calendar.
# The compression sidecar authenticates to the collector with the token set directly below.

secret setting of yafof-tawep: RELAY_SECRET8=8abb5772